Output d8b01a579981b51a411cfe7fa63516cb8d0d849bfdfe0960c9d1003242629190:0

value
386279880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71df48bd661b79d339eec68ed97c4021a6020ad9 OP_EQUAL
address
3C57mGt4u8cSpfRnen8LSYN2tJ2XnCx87i
transaction
d8b01a579981b51a411cfe7fa63516cb8d0d849bfdfe0960c9d1003242629190
spent
true